HFM Mobile application (Android)

Help us document damage on the ground using our dedicated mobile application. Its offline functionality allows you to collect data even without a stable internet connection. 

Key Features:

  • User-friendly interface
  • Offline data collection capability
  • GPS location recording
  • Option to upload photos and videos
  • Supports Burmese and English languages

Artifact Inventory Form

Following an earthquake, you can submit information and photos of artifacts, relics, statues, and other ancient objects that have discovered or exposed from damaged and collapsed buildings using the Artifact Inventory Web Form.

ICCROM ICH Damage Assessment Form

Following an earthquake, potential impacts on intangible cultural heritage can be reported using the ICCROM ICH Damage Assessment Web Form designed for assessing damage to intangible cultural heritage.
